Angina

Image
In the winter, I first noticed pain in my chest when pushing myself on steeper runs while skiing.  I originally thought it was from the terrible air quality, and the pain was originating from my lungs.  Once Covid19 had run though and slowed or stopped all of the factories in the area, the air quality was fantastic. In the spring, I went out camping in a remote spot in a valley where I knew I wouldn't come across any other campers, but still get my two young boys out into nature.  Climbing out of the valley with all of our gear, in that perfect clean air, I felt the same chest pain and knew that my original assessment was wrong, and I likely had a heart condition.  I made an appointment to see a cardiologist the next week.
